Rockstar Games has published the trailer for Grand Theft Auto 6, the highly anticipated video game. The trailer left fans buzzing on social media platforms. The last edition of the Grand Auto Theft franchise was GTA 5, which was released back in 2013.

Grand Theft Auto 6 will be officially released in 2025, as per the trailer announcement. The trailer gained more than 90 million views on YouTube. Which single-handedly broke numerous records. 

Fans and enthusiasts are celebrating the iconic game on their own. UFC fans are also excited about the game and comparing the main protagonists with UFC middleweight champion and UFC interviewer and social media star Nina Drama.

Nina Drama reacts to fans comparing her to GTA 6 character 

Nina Maria, other than her interviews, is best known for her humor and interaction with fans' memes. Nina responded to a fan on X (formerly Twitter), who was comparing her with Lucia, one of the main protagonists of the game.

She quoted the tweet by a fan and expressed, “Ready for my GTA 6 debut LOL.”

Sean Strickland reacts to fans comparing him to a GTA 6 character 

UFC fans have even compared UFC middleweight champion Sean Strickland with one of  Grand Auto Theft's main characters. Now Tarzan himself has reacted to memes comparing him to the GTA protagonist.

Strickland even took some shots at EA games. EA Games is the company that produces UFC games. The latest game was released recently, UFC 5.

“I'd rather be in Rockstar Games than an EA game. But to EA credit they give the fans what they want. We have always wanted to play a disabled trans female in WW2.. Thanks, EA. you really deliver.”

Another fan even compared Strickland with the GTA 5 character Trevor. Tarzan quoted the tweet and expressed, “my future.”
